Introduction

Roundedswitch.PNG

This widget is a checkbox widget that is represented by a switch button.

It has the same API than the Button widget API, but the look is different.

Please notice that the widget only consists in a checkbox without text. You can not setText(something), you have to create a Label widget besides the checkbox.

Usage

You use this widget like a Button with SWT.CHECKBOX style :

 final RoundedSwitch button = new RoundedCheckbox(shell, SWT.NONE);
 button.setSelection(true);

And voilà, it is done !

Examples

An example called RoundedCheckBoxSnippet.java is located in the plugin org.eclipse.nebula.widgets.roundedcheckbox.snippets.
